// Mantid Repository : https://github.com/mantidproject/mantid
//
// Copyright © 2019 ISIS Rutherford Appleton Laboratory UKRI,
// NScD Oak Ridge National Laboratory, European Spallation Source,
// Institut Laue - Langevin & CSNS, Institute of High Energy Physics, CAS
// SPDX - License - Identifier: GPL - 3.0 +
#include "MantidKernel/TopicInfo.h"
#include "MantidKernel/InstrumentInfo.h"
#include "MantidKernel/Logger.h"
#include <Poco/DOM/Element.h>
#include <utility>
namespace Mantid::Kernel {
namespace {
// static logger object
Logger g_log("TopicInfo");
std::string typeToString(TopicType type) {
switch (type) {
case TopicType::Event:
return "Event";
case TopicType::Monitor:
return "Monitor";
case TopicType::Sample:
return "Sample";
case TopicType::Chopper:
return "Chopper";
case TopicType::Run:
return "Run";
default:
return "unspecified";
}
}
} // namespace
TopicInfo::TopicInfo(InstrumentInfo *inst, const Poco::XML::Element *elem) {
m_name = elem->getAttribute("name");
if (m_name.empty())
g_log.warning() << "Kafka topic provided without a suitable name for instrument " << inst->name()
<< ". No attempts will be made to connect to this topic." << std::endl;
std::string type = elem->getAttribute("type");
if (type == "event")
m_type = TopicType::Event;
else if (type == "chopper")
m_type = TopicType::Chopper;
else if (type == "sample")
m_type = TopicType::Sample;
else if (type == "run")
m_type = TopicType::Run;
else if (type == "monitor")
m_type = TopicType::Monitor;
else
g_log.warning() << "Kafka topic provided without a suitable type for instrument " << inst->name()
<< ". No attempts will be made to connect to this topic." << std::endl;
}
TopicInfo::TopicInfo(std::string name, TopicType type) : m_name(std::move(name)), m_type(type) {}
/**
* Prints the listener to the stream.
*
* @param buffer :: A reference to an output stream
* @param topic :: A reference to a TopicInfo object
* @return A reference to the stream written to
*/
std::ostream &operator<<(std::ostream &buffer, const TopicInfo &topic) {
buffer << topic.name() << "(" << typeToString(topic.type()) << ", "
<< ")";
return buffer;
}
} // namespace Mantid::Kernel
